Bolaños on The cost of "Winning at Any Cost"


by: Bolanos for Congress

Tue Oct 10, 2006 at 11:48 AM CDT


to be cross-posted at Daily Kos

As Republicans brag about how aggressively and swiftly they took care of Mark Foley, supposedly "forcing" him to resign (ya, sure); news from other sources tells a tragically different and surprising story about those controlling our government, for far too long now.

With every day that passes, more evidence comes to light proving that too many Republican lawmakers, including its leaders, knew about Foley wooing our below-the-age-of-consent pages, the young wards entrusted-fully to Congress' care and protection, by equally-innocent parents.

One of the latest revelations is that of Congressman Kolbe R-AZ. He reports having learned of lurid messages from Foley to a page as long as six years ago, and says that he confronted Foley about them immediately.

Although it now seems clear that many Republicans knew about Foley-the-Predator for years, but chose the "Gentleman's Agreement" way of quietly handling Foley, instead of protecting our youths from him; Republicans blame Democrats. And they do so with immunity, without any sense of shame or hypocrisy.

During the weekend, you could catch video clips of Speaker Denny Hastert DEMANDING INVESTIGATIONS!!!, ---- investigations into whether there was a Democrat somewhere in the story behind how ABC learned about Foley preying on these young people.

They can't help it, can they?

When caught breaking the law by spying on Quakers peaceably assembling, they demanded INVESTIGATIONS!!, investigations into how the press found out.  When caught supporting off-the-radar prisons in places where torture can be carried out, without public notice, they demanded INVESTIGATIONS!!, investigations into how the media learned of these unlawful detention centers.

For years, they had the national media trained like organ-grinder monkeys to treat Democrats like untrustworthy buffoons, and Republicans as if they were above reproach, so much wiser and moral than any Democrat could ever be; yes, perfect beings every one.

Media virtually ignored the stories that revealed the cold, black hearts of these Hypocrites, self-adorned in Christian clothing.

Set-aside the fact that Christianity is all about helping the poor and infirmed, and not about harassing gays, poking your nose into people's deeply-private lives, or helping the rich and powerful, who clearly need no help from government. Forget that this administration has eroded away decades of progress towards helping people overcome their misfortune, to the greater good of our nation.  Instead,

just consider a story or two that some in the press covered, while the rest of media put their fingers in their ears and sang loudly lalalalalalalala, until that moment passed.

The quintessential example includes DeLay, Abramoff, the Commonwealth of the Northern Mariana Islands (CNMI), and sexual slavery.  Cloaked by the banner "FREE ENTERPRISE!", "Christian" Tom Delay, through steadfast lobbying and high-priced junkets to the Mariana Islands, an "American protectorate" (so that Congressmen could live the good-life, with the best food and wine, at ritzy hotels) helped pass laws to ensure that the people of CNMI could not enjoy the protection provided by US labor laws. He and the laws he helped pass enable the slavery that thrives in the CNMI today.

While DeLay and his supporters claim to be Anti-Abortion advocates, they're actually Anti-Choice mongers. In CNMI, when the inevitable occurs and the enslaved women become pregnant, there is No "Choice" for them. Employers make the decision and that decision is abortion.  Remarkably, DeLay has praised the pro-Abortion, anti-Choice employers with "You are a shining light for what is happening to the Republican Party, and you represent everything that is good about what we are trying to do in America and leading the world in the free-market system."

Now over a year and a half old, the Marianas story should have been more than enough to wake America up, to make all media and Americans finally realize that those in charge are Hypocrites, only shells of Christianity and Wisdom, filled with an incompetent, seemingly evil interior.

Marianas should have been enough to show the world that the mantra of those currently in charge is "Winning is Everything and No Cost is too High." 


When the cost was "merely" the lives and the freedom of young Asian women, too few in America noticed or cared.

Now that we see that the Speaker of the House and other leading Republicans have also been willing to pay with the innocence of our youth, year-after-year, the culture of this country may finally start returning to sanity and truth.

Sacrificing our young, just to maintain their false fronts of wise piety and their firm grip on our nation, seems to be the trigger for the American people to finally, finally lose their long-time respect for the Republican's "Winning At Any Cost" articles of faith.
